Challenges and Opportunities Facing SMEs in a Globalized Market

In today's rapidly evolving shifting global marketplace, Small and Medium-sized Enterprises (SMEs) are presented with both unprecedented challenges and exciting possibilities. While globalization offers immense potential for expansion, SMEs face a number of constraints that can hinder their achievement.

One major concern is the increasing competition from larger, more seasoned corporations with greater capital. SMEs may also struggle to modify get more info to rapidly changing consumer trends and demands. Furthermore, navigating complex regulatory frameworks and global trade agreements can be a considerable undertaking for SMEs with limited experience.

Nevertheless, globalization also presents a wealth of possibilities for SMEs. Access to new regions can drive revenue growth and enable SMEs to broaden their product or service offerings.

Furthermore, advancements in technology have diminished the challenges to entry for SMEs, providing them with tools to compete on a more equitable playing field. By leveraging these possibilities, SMEs can position themselves for long-term growth and success in the global marketplace.

Exploring the Financial Landscape: Funding Options for SMEs

Securing adequate funding is critical to the growth of any small or medium-sized enterprise (SME). The financial landscape can be nuanced, presenting a spectrum of funding options for entrepreneurs to utilize.

Established lending institutions like banks often provide loans, but their requirements can be restrictive. Innovative funding sources are also emerging, including crowdfunding platforms, angel investors, and venture capital firms. Each funding avenue comes with its own benefits and drawbacks.

SME leaders must thoroughly evaluate their needs, financial health, and long-term objectives before opt ing for a funding strategy.

Building a Sustainable Future: ESG Practices for SMEs

Small and medium-sized enterprises organizations (SMEs) are increasingly recognized as key players in building a sustainable future. By adopting environmental, social, and governance responsibility practices, SMEs can not only minimize their influence on the planet but also enhance their reputation among consumers and investors.

Integrating ESG considerations into business models offers a multitude of benefits. Firstly, it helps SMEs minimize their environmental footprint by embracing eco-friendly practices such as energy management and waste reduction. Secondly, strong social ethics fosters a positive work environment and promotes equality, leading to increased employee engagement. Lastly, sound governance frameworks enhance transparency and accountability, building confidence with stakeholders.

  • Implementing ESG practices can gain investors who prioritize sustainability.
  • Sustainable SMEs are often more resilient to future challenges and market shifts.
  • By embracing ESG, SMEs contribute to a more equitable and sustainable world.
